Understanding TPMS Sensors
Before diving into the buying guide, let us first understand what TPMS sensors are and their purpose. As the name suggests, these sensors monitor the air pressure in your vehicle’s tires and alert you if there is any deviation from the recommended pressure. This helps in maintaining proper tire pressure, which not only improves fuel efficiency but also ensures safe driving.
Types of TPMS Sensors
There are two types of TPMS sensors – direct and indirect. Direct sensors use individual sensors attached to each tire’s valve stem to measure tire pressure and transmit data to the vehicle’s computer system. Indirect sensors, on the other hand, use wheel speed sensors to detect variations in tire rotations caused by under-inflated tires.
For Toyota Tacomas manufactured after 2007, it is recommended to use direct TPMS sensors as they provide more accurate readings and have longer battery life compared to indirect ones.
Compatibility with Toyota Tacoma
When buying a TPMS sensor for your Toyota Tacoma, it is crucial to ensure that it is compatible with your specific model year. Each sensor has a unique identification number that needs to be programmed into your vehicle’s computer system for it to function correctly.
For older models of Toyota Tacomas (pre-2007), it is essential to check if your truck has been retrofitted for direct TPMS sensors before purchasing them.
OEM vs Aftermarket Sensors
O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) sensors are those produced by the same company that manufactured your vehicle. They are designed specifically for your model and provide accurate readings. However, they can be more expensive than aftermarket options.
Aftermarket sensors are produced by third-party manufacturers and may not have the same quality standards as OEM ones. It is crucial to do thorough research before purchasing an aftermarket sensor as compatibility issues and inaccurate readings have been reported by some users.
